You can get access to the most subtle sound efficiency in a high definition quality levels.It comes with a Total Purity Concept that provides access to a high drive amp technology. Fully discrete power amplification with minimal distortion would be one of the exciting features offered by the platform. The independent power supply to analog and digital circuitry will ensure the effective prevention of digital noise from affecting the performance level. The anti-vibration heat sinks can further help suppress the vibration due to transistors and other elements of sound pressure.The Anti-Resonance Technology Wedge can be yet another advantage that helps take care of the vibrations likely from the power transformer, power transistors, and heat sinks, or even from the speakers.The features offered by the receiver includeA powerful 4K HDMI support. The advanced sound optimization offered through YPAO – Reflected Sound Control offers you exciting sound optimization options. This technology takes into account the room acoustics and calibrates the speaker’s characteristics.It also provides access to DSP Effect Normalization, which further ensures a studio-quality sound performance. Get access to the best performance standard with 4K Ultra HD, HDR10, Dolby Vision™, Hybrid Log-Gamma, and BT.2020. You can have access to voice control through Google Assistant and Amazon Alexa. You can also access Siri through AirPlay 2.You can also connect it with MusicCast 20 or MusicCast 50 speakers for creating the 5.1 channel surround sound experience.The 4K Ultra HD HDMI Support offers you access to Dolby Vision and Hybrid Log-Gamma. Two HDMI outputs help you connect with TV and video projector performance.
